Mountain Longleaf National Wildlife Refuge-AL, AL
Mountain Longleaf National Wildlife Refuge was established May 29, 2003 on the former military training lands of Fort McClellan. The refuge protects and manages the last remaining old growth stands and the best remaining mountain longleaf pine forests in the Southeast. The 9,000-acre mountain refuge contains beautiful vistas and a rugged landscape of unfragmented forests.
